Krupal Balaji Tumane (Template:Lang-mr) is an Indian politician from Nagpur who is re-Elected in 17th Lok Sabha[1]Template:Circular reference & was member of the 16th Lok Sabha of India. He represented the Ramtek constituency of Nagpur district, Maharashtra and is a member of the Shiv Sena political party. He defeated sitting MP and former Cabinet Minister Mukul Wasnik of Indian National Congress Party.[2][3]
Positions held
- 2019: Re-Elected to 17th Lok Sabha[4]
- 2014: Elected to 16th Lok Sabha[5]
- 14 Aug. 2014 onwards Member, Committee on Welfare of Scheduled Castes and Scheduled Tribes[6]
- 1 Sep. 2014 onwards Member, Standing Committee on Coal and Steel
- 3 Sep. 2014 onwards Member, Consultative Committee,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as
